The charm of a dainty moissanite ring lies not only in its aesthetic appeal but also in its fascinating origin story. Moissanite was discovered over a century ago by French scientist Henri Moissan in a meteor crater in Arizona. This cosmic connection adds a layer of mystique to the gemstone, giving your engagement ring a story as unique as your own romance. In a world where diamonds often dominate the conversation, moissanite offers an exciting alternative for those who are looking for something out of the ordinary.
Moreover, what truly sets moissanite apart is its ethical and sustainable production. While traditional diamond mining has a storied and often troubling environmental and human rights impact, moissanite is lab-created, meaning it doesn't carry the same ethical baggage. Supporting eco-friendly practices while also saving a little on the budget is a delightful bonus for anyone looking to blend conscience with style.
